Eintracht Frankfurt vs Hamburger SV – Lineups & Match Details
Hamburger SV beat Eintracht Frankfurt 2-1. Goals: C. Uzun (48'), A. Grønbæk (51'), Fábio Vieira (59'). Eintracht Frankfurt had 64% possession against Hamburger SV's 36%. Shots on target: 5-4.

Match preview
Eintracht Frankfurt host Hamburger SV on Saturday, 2 May 2026. The kick-off time is 13:30 local. The fixture is part of the Bundesliga schedule. Eintracht Frankfurt go into the match 8th in the table; Hamburger SV sit 11th. The two squads have prepared for a tight contest.
Form coming in
Eintracht Frankfurt have taken 1 win, 2 draws and 2 losses from their last 5. Recent run: 1 draw. Hamburger SV have collected 0 wins, 1 draw and 4 losses over the same span. Recent run: 3 losses in a row.
Head to head
The two clubs have met 3 times recently. Past results: 20 Dec 2025: Eintracht Frankfurt 1-1 Hamburger SV; 5 May 2018: Eintracht Frankfurt 3-0 Hamburger SV; 12 Dec 2017: Eintracht Frankfurt 2-1 Hamburger SV. The series gives both sides something to draw on before kick-off.
Match recap
Hamburger SV beat Eintracht Frankfurt 2-1. Eintracht Frankfurt scored through C. Uzun 48'. Hamburger SV replied with A. Grønbæk 51', Fábio Vieira 59'. The decisive goal arrived in minute 59 as the contest closed.
Stat highlights
Eintracht Frankfurt held 64% of the ball against 36% for Hamburger SV. Shots on target finished 5-4. Expected goals read 0.70 for Eintracht Frankfurt, 0.60 for Hamburger SV.
